Output baa354934f33ff9507bf6596bcd331193241f0c4b5d9189ab0d8cb887ab1d494:26

value
25888788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761f97a0a0418c01639b5efd93ad6b2365985cac OP_EQUAL
address
MJfjp8v7mCDJ3LhwJu3BUbkE9drJuuET3H
transaction
baa354934f33ff9507bf6596bcd331193241f0c4b5d9189ab0d8cb887ab1d494
spent
true